Do you mean the model answer? It looks fine to me. The only thing I will say though is that for general jurisdiction SCOTUS recently has completely done away with continuous and systematic activity. Freer mentioned this but the model answer still hits on it. The sole test is now whether the corp is "at home" in the forum state.

On July 17, 2015 Barbri tweeted that "the overall pass rate nationwide was 91% for students that completed 75% of the work" ... And clarified by saying "we mean 75% of AMP, 3 graded essays, did the Simulated MBE and 75% of PSP" (see https://mobile.twitter.com/barbri/statu ... 0614282240)

They also said that 98 schools had a 100% pass rate for students that completed 75% of the work, while 152 schools had a pass rate of atleast 90% that completed 75%
